Carnevale: La Serenissima

With Mr T being busy for the last two weeks we've not played any games but I have been working on some stuff for Carnevale. I'm a big fan of terrain and as TT Combat do a big range of MDF terrain for the game I took the plunge and purchased a load to replace the cardboard buildings that come in the starter set.

This meant I've been spending the last week or so splashing the glue around and breathing in the fumes of burnt MDF, so it was a real relief to get at least all the buildings done. The box I bought also contains some MDF street sections but as I have the foam ones already I'm leaving those for later on.


As this weekend has been extra sunny I managed to get the buildings out into the back yard and spray some white primer over them, I could only get one can so the coverage wasn't a great as I would have liked but as MDF soaks up the paint anyway it should be a decent enough start.


I've also started to lay down some of the base coat colours as well. I've decided to go for five different main colours and then pick out the windows etc afterwards. This should give a nice bright and varied look to the terrain on the table. I'm not sure how historically accurate this is but hopefully it should look good when we play. 



This feels like it is going to be a big job to get completed but as the terrain is together it can at least be used for games whilst I paint it up. Hopefully we should be back to playing next week.
